Foundation jacking is a process used to stabilize and lift a building’s foundation that has shifted or settled over time. This service involves inserting hydraulic jacks beneath the existing foundation and carefully raising it back to its proper position. The procedure is typically performed with precision to ensure the structure's alignment is restored without causing damage. Foundation jacking can be a practical solution for homeowners facing uneven floors, cracked walls, or doors and windows that no longer close properly due to foundation movement.

This service helps address a variety of common problems associated with foundation settlement. When the soil beneath a property shifts or becomes unstable, it can cause the foundation to sink or become uneven. This can lead to structural issues such as cracked walls, uneven flooring, or gaps around door frames. Foundation jacking offers a way to correct these issues by re-leveling the foundation, which can prevent further damage and improve the stability of the property. It is often used as part of a broader foundation repair plan to restore safety and functionality to a home.

Properties that typically require foundation jacking include residential homes, especially those built on expansive or shifting soils. Older houses with settled foundations may also benefit from this service, as well as new constructions experiencing early signs of movement. Commercial buildings, multi-family units, and other structures with concrete or pier-and-beam foundations can also be candidates for foundation jacking. What is foundation jacking? Foundation jacking is a process that lifts and stabilizes a building's foundation using hydraulic or mechanical equipment to correct settling or shifting issues.

When should foundation jacking be considered? Foundation jacking may be recommended if there are signs of uneven floors, cracked walls, or other structural concerns indicating foundation movement.

How do local contractors perform foundation jacking? Contractors typically assess the foundation, then use specialized equipment to lift and reinforce the foundation, ensuring stability and alignment.

Is foundation jacking suitable for all types of foundations? Foundation jacking is commonly used for concrete slab and pier-and-beam foundations, but suitability depends on individual conditions and should be evaluated by a professional.

What are common signs that foundation jacking might be needed? Indicators include uneven flooring, cracked walls or ceilings, sticking doors or windows, and visible foundation settlement or movement.
